Location: AA Headquarters 1 (DFW-HDQ1)Additional Locations: Ft Worth, TXRequisition ID: 29760Job DescriptionThe Temporary Worker Program is a provisional employment opportunity that has been the starting point for many of our current employees. A temporary worker is engaged to supplement the workforce during periods of unusual or emergency workload, leave of absence or vacation. A temporary worker can be engaged to perform tasks ranging from routine to highly complex. Length of assignments vary up to a maximum of six (6) months.During your tenure as a temporary worker, we'll work with you to find the right positions based on your education and former employment. You'll be able to visit various departments within American to help you better understand our company and make informed decisions about your future career path with us. We'll support your search for a full-time permanent position by providing assistance with resume writing and interview techniques that will prepare you for internal interviews at American Airlines. Temporary workers have the benefit of applying for the Company's internal vacancies on the first day of their assignment. However, the temporary position does not include employee medical benefits or flight privileges.What does a Member Services Rep-Mortgage Services - Temporary Worker do?
Prepares pre-closing loan quality Initiative requirements, credit analysis, and quality control of the loan information
Provides accurate closing and funding of our mortgage loans in all 50 states plus the Virgin Islands using the Prime Alliance LFC system
Serves in a backup role for initial member contact via incoming phone calls and for taking applications through our Prime Alliance loan origination system
